Dbrand’s Switch 2 Joy-Con Grip Detachment Fix Is Finally Here
Many Nintendo Switch 2 users faced a frustrating issue: Joy-Con grips detaching from the console when using Dbrand’s Killswitch case. After widespread complaints and a public acknowledgment of its “spectacularly terrible response,” Dbrand has now rolled out a proper fix. The company’s redesigned grips, branded as Joy-Lock, promise to keep controllers securely attached, even under pressure. This new design replaces the faulty grips entirely—no tweaks, no half measures.
How Joy-Lock Fixes the Switch 2 Joy-Con Grip Detachment Problem
The Joy-Lock system addresses the root cause of the detachment issue by reinforcing the connection between the Joy-Con and the Switch 2 console. In a demonstration video, Dbrand shows how the redesigned grips stay firmly in place even when the entire console is suspended by a single controller. This redesign isn’t just cosmetic—it’s a hardware-level improvement aimed at boosting user confidence and preventing accidental drops.
Dbrand Adds More Fixes with Silicone Dock Pads
Beyond the Joy-Con grips, Dbrand is also improving the Killswitch experience for docked users. A new set of silicone friction pads will be included with every updated Dock Adapter. These help prevent one-handed undocking mishaps, keeping the adapter firmly seated in Nintendo’s official dock. It’s a thoughtful touch that addresses another user-reported frustration and enhances overall stability during gameplay and charging.
What to Expect Next from Dbrand and Shipping Timeline
According to Dbrand, a full production schedule for the updated Joy-Lock grips will be shared early next week. All new orders and unshipped Killswitch cases will include the redesigned grips and pre-installed silicone dock pads. For those who already purchased the earlier version, Dbrand confirms they’ll be able to claim their free replacements soon. While the company initially brushed off the complaints, it’s now taking the right steps to rebuild trust and deliver on its promise of quality.
